Output 6fab348fef43a0d736309d33e31d0bfa4369131c7ac5050086df5174d4cecacc:12

value
20149253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d4789b1fd5c3a10719cc4ddf793918cad5a8e81 OP_EQUAL
address
MU5BGN25phDUo1boSkeng1BfatHWxA2qqA
transaction
6fab348fef43a0d736309d33e31d0bfa4369131c7ac5050086df5174d4cecacc
spent
true